The Ladies Of Gatsby


Daisy Buchanan - Nick’s cousin, and the woman Gatsby loves. As a young woman in Louisville before the war, Daisy was persued by a number of officers, including Gatsby. She fell in love with Gatsby and promised to wait for him. However, Daisy has a deep need to be loved, and when a wealthy, powerful young man named Tom Buchanan asked her to marry him, Daisy decided not to wait for Gatsby after all. Now a beautiful women of high society, Daisy lives with Tom across from Gatsby in the fashionable East Egg district of Long Island. She is somewhat cynical, and behaves superficially to mask her pain at Tom's constant infidelity.






Jordan Baker - Daisy’s friend, a woman that Nick becomes romantically involved during the summer. A competitive golfer, Jordan represents one of the “new women” of the 1920s—cynical, boyish, and self-centered. Jordan is beautiful, but also dishonest: she cheated in order to win her first golf tournament and continually bends the truth.







Myrtle Wilson - Tom’s lover, whose husband George owns a run-down garage in the valley of ashes. Myrtle herself has a fierce vitality and desperately looks for a way to improve her situation. Unfortunately for her, she chooses Tom, who treats her as a mere object of his desire.
